IEEE PES Power System Analysis, Computing and Economics Committee

Adcom Meeting

July 23, 2002

Chicago, IL

Attendance

members and guests signed in - Joann Staron, Cliff Grigg, Marti Baughman, Chen-Ching Liu, Kevin Tomsovic, Sando Carneiro, Edwin Liu and Ross Baldick.

Chair Report

Joann mentioned that Roger Dugan and Ali Abur are the new editors for the Transactions. Since the PES meeting structure has changed, the PSACE Adcom has decided to meet once a year at the General Meetings. The first one is the General Meeting 2003. It is also decided that the Adcom will meet through teleconference for a second meeting when it is necessary. The motion was approved. It is also suggested that CAMS meet at PICA. T&D has established a new subcommittee on power quality. It is decided that Dr. Surya Santoso will be invited to serve as the representative for PSACE. Kevin Tomsovic will invite Surya. PSACE subcommittee chairs should join the Standards Association to be eligible to vote on standards.

Vice Chair Report

Marti reported that PES conference papers will be handled electronically starting from the Toronto meeting. He also mentioned that there is a new publication from PES, "Power & Energy Magazine," which will be distributed electronically. Panel sessions should use power points. PES will ask panelists to submit the slides and distribute through PES. He also reminded that panelist summaries must be submitted in order for the panelist to be listed in the program.

Sec'y Report

Chen-Ching reported that the prize paper award forms will be sent to PSACE editors and subcommittee chairs for nomination. He also reported that PSACE Fellow WG ranking to PES Fellow Committee was not submitted this year. Chen-Ching mentioned that Risk, Reliability subcommittee scope is missing in the PSACE operating manual. He also requested the subcommittee member lists from the chairs before July 31, 2002. In the future, an invitation letter will be sent by the PSACE Chair to new members approved by the Adcom. At this meeting, the following new members are approved by the Adcom, Andy Ford, PJM Hisao Taoka, Mitsubishi Electric, Japan Chan-Nan Lu, National Sun Yat Sen University, Taiwan

Standards - Cliff Grigg

Cliff reported that all materials must be electronic. New standards are being developed on Internet security. A survey on IEEE standards on electronic security issues will be conducted. PSACE needs to appoint a representative on the task force. Cliff will be the representative for now. PSACE has two existing standards that will not be affected.

Summary of Subcommittee Reports:

Ross Baldick:

Subcommittee is interested in engineering issues related to markets. A joint task force is established on terms related to markets.

Sandoval Carneiro:

Subcommittee is concerned that the attendance of the subcommittee is low. Combined paper and panel sessions will be organized for GM 2004.

Kevin Tomsovic:

Two panel and 2 paper sessions were organized for the SM 2002. Two panel sessions are planned for the next meeting - data mining and multi-agent systems. A new task force on intelligent data analysis is chaired by Surya Santoso.

Cliff Grigg:

Two paper and two panel sessions were organized in SM 2002. Bob Fletcher will head a task force. The effort will be coordinated with Distribution Subcommittee. Ross suggested that test systems be included.

Edwin Liu:

Two paper sessions, 2 panel sessions and 1 poster session were organized for SM 2002. The number of papers is lower than before.

CAMS has been active in PICA. The conference is evolving into Power System Conference and Exhibit. Edwin needs to know which committees will meet at the even year conferences. He needs inputs from the Adcom.
